For months, supporters of H.Con.Res. 362 have defended themselves against critics who argue that the bill poses a serious risk of escalating the conflict between the US and Iran. several cosponsors (four of whom have since withdrawn their cosponsorship) have openly stated that the resolution's blockade language must be removed in order for them to support it. Other cosponsors have lobbied House Speaker not to allow a vote. |
